## Artifact Signing

Both the Kestrelink Java SDK and the Swift SDK must reach feature parity before each release, and their artifacts are signed with the same key so downstream verification stays uniform. Contractors: run the parity checker first, then the signing step. The signing step prompts for the shared release key, which is:

rollout seal: bky4_yke3

Present: Dana Velloran (chair), Miro Antsel, Petra Quill.

Dana walked us through the landlord's counteroffer: a three-year extension with a modest rent bump but a bigger service charge. Miro flagged that the parking clause is still vague and wants it nailed down. Petra estimates we'd save roughly 12% versus relocating to the Caldmere site. We agreed to push back on the escalation clause and reconvene Thursday. Context on why timing matters is summarised below.

board note of kageg-bahof: The renewal with Holwynax Holdings closes at $2 million a year, 5 percent below the last contract. Project Ulaath slips by two quarters because of the supplier delay.

## Briefing: Dresmore Plant Capacity

For the incoming director. Dresmore runs at 92% capacity; demand forecasts exceed output by Q3. Options: third shift, line automation upgrade, or shifting volume to the Kelbach facility. Capital committee meets next month. Staffing and supplier constraints are documented in the annex. The preferred option is recorded below.

management briefing: The renewal with Zoraelax Group closes at $10 million a year, 15 percent below the last contract. Project Ralael slips by six weeks because of the audit delay.

Subject: DR drill Thursday — monthly partitions

Hi on-call,

Thursday's drill restores the Ledgerbay orders table, partitioned by month, onto the standby cluster. You'll detach the last three partitions, restore from snapshot, and reattach in order. The restore console will ask for the drill recovery passphrase before mounting snapshots. It is listed below for convenience.

vault phrase of tajeg-tageg = pelix-druix-holius-briael-zorwyn-frawyn-fraox-norok-drueth-aldiel